What is cloud computing?
On-demand access to computing resources such as CPU, storage, and networking delivered over the internet.
Cloud computing allows users to access and utilize computing resources without direct active management.
What is a key advantage of global accessibility in cloud computing?
Cloud services can be deployed anywhere in the world with access to large-scale resources.
This enables businesses to reach a global audience and utilize resources efficiently.
What does rapid deployment mean in cloud computing?
Applications and services can be deployed almost instantly without building physical infrastructure.
This feature enhances agility and responsiveness to market demands.
What is scalability in cloud computing?
The ability to increase or decrease resources based on demand.
Scalability ensures that resources can be adjusted to meet varying workloads.
What is elasticity in cloud computing?
Automatically scaling resources up or down to match workload needs, helping control costs.
Elasticity allows for efficient resource utilization and cost management.
What is geographical flexibility in the cloud?
The ability to deploy applications in regions closest to users to improve performance and reduce latency.
This feature enhances user experience by minimizing delays.
What is a public cloud?
Cloud services provided by third-party vendors and accessed over the internet.
Public clouds are typically available to multiple customers.

What is a private cloud?
Cloud infrastructure built and managed within an organization’s own data center.
Private clouds offer enhanced security and control for organizations.
What is a main advantage of a private cloud?
Greater control over security, data, and infrastructure.
Organizations can customize their cloud environment to meet specific needs.
What is a community cloud?
A shared cloud infrastructure used by multiple organizations with similar needs.
Community clouds help organizations collaborate while sharing costs.
Why would organizations use a community cloud?
To share costs while meeting common regulatory or operational requirements.
This model is beneficial for organizations with similar compliance needs.
What is Infrastructure as a Service (IaaS)?
A cloud model where the provider supplies hardware resources, and the customer manages the OS, applications, and data.
IaaS offers flexibility in managing computing resources.
What is a key advantage of IaaS?
High flexibility and control over the operating system and applications.
Customers can tailor their environments to specific requirements.
What is a disadvantage of IaaS?
It requires more management and maintenance by the customer.
Customers must have the expertise to manage their infrastructure.
What is Software as a Service (SaaS)?
On-demand software where the provider manages everything, including updates and data.
SaaS simplifies software management for users.

What does the user manage in a SaaS model?
Only user access and configuration—no infrastructure or software maintenance.
This allows users to focus on using the software rather than managing it.
What is Platform as a Service (PaaS)?
A cloud model that provides a platform for developing and running applications while the provider manages the underlying infrastructure.
PaaS streamlines the development process for developers.
What is the customer responsible for in PaaS?
Developing and managing their own applications.
Customers can focus on application development without worrying about infrastructure.

What is the cloud responsibility matrix?
A comparison showing which components are managed by the cloud provider and which are managed by the customer across IaaS, PaaS, and SaaS.
This matrix helps clarify responsibilities in cloud service models.
Which cloud model gives the customer the most responsibility?
Infrastructure as a Service (IaaS).
Customers have significant control over their infrastructure in this model.
Which cloud model gives the customer the least responsibility?
Software as a Service (SaaS).
The provider manages most aspects of the service in this model.
